Woori Financial Group Targets Revenue Recovery, Raises Future Partnership Growth Target to 90 Trillion Won

According to Yonhap Infomax, Woori Financial Group held a management strategy workshop on July 16, with its chairman and representatives from 16 subsidiaries in attendance. Chairman Im Jong-ryong emphasized that the second half of 2026 should prioritize revenue recovery, cost competitiveness, and financial soundness, with the group to move faster than competitors.

The group achieved 82.5% of its first-half productive finance target of 21.8 trillion won. Last month, Woori raised its five-year Future Partnership Growth Project target from 80 trillion won to 90 trillion won.
